The Specter of Devil Worship, Part Two

Historical Blindness show

Summary: In part two of a Halloween special, Mike Brown and I continue to scrutinize claims of devil worship throughout history. Go back and listen to part one, if you haven't already. Listener beware: this subject matter involves alleged violent crimes against children.